About 1-(5-amino-1-methylpyrazol-4-yl)ethanone

1-(5-amino-1-methylpyrazol-4-yl)ethanone (PubChem CID 11412428) has the molecular formula C6H9N3O and a molecular weight of 139.16 g/mol. Its IUPAC name is 1-(5-amino-1-methylpyrazol-4-yl)ethanone.
